The village and civil parish of Little Baddow lies in the district of Chelmsford in rural Essex, a short drive from the city. It is set among rolling farmland with pockets of ancient woodland and heath, and is known locally for its network of footpaths and quiet lanes that appeal to walkers and nature lovers.
Little Baddow has a long history visible in timber‑framed cottages, a medieval parish church and a number of listed buildings, and retains a lively community feel centred on the village hall, the local pub and seasonal events. The local economy is largely residential with farming and small businesses present, while many inhabitants commute to Chelmsford or London for work.
